Located at 10960 104 Street NW, Edmonton, Alberta, T5H 2W6, Polish Club Syrena is a delightful culinary establishment specializing in authentic Polish cuisine. For those looking to experience the rich flavors and traditional dishes of Poland, this club is a definite must-visit.
Here are some tips for enjoying your time at Polish Club Syrena:
1. Try the classics: Indulge in traditional Polish dishes such as pierogi, kielbasa, and bigos (hunter's stew) for a true taste of Poland.
2. Explore the menu: Apart from the classics, the menu also offers a variety of lesser-known Polish specialties, such as golabki (stuffed cabbage rolls) and placki ziemniaczane (potato pancakes). Don't be afraid to try something new.
3. Polish desserts: Leave some room for Polish sweets, including favorites like makowiec (poppy seed roll) and szarlotka (apple pie). These treats are a perfect way to end your meal.
4. Cultural experience: Polish Club Syrena often hosts events, including live music and dancing, providing a vibrant and engaging atmosphere that allows visitors to immerse themselves in Polish traditions.
5. Friendly ambiance: The welcoming staff and cozy atmosphere create a warm and inviting environment that is perfect for intimate dinners or gatherings with friends and family.
